Skalkottas and his “Berlin cycle”

Overview
TRIBUTE TO NIKOS SKALKOTTAS
A retrospective which will continue into next year, attempting to cover all those parts of Skalkottas’s oeuvre: pieces for orchestra, chamber music, Inter-war Berlin and a symposium on the Greek composer with the largest international impact in the 20th century.
